#574c20 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#574c20 is composed of 34.1% red, 29.8%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.6%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 48 degrees, a saturation of 46.2% and a lightness of 23.3%. #574c20 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ae9840 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#574c20 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#574c20 has RGB values of R:87, G:76,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.63,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5721120.

Shades and Tints of #574c20
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#faf8f2 is the lightest one.
